Question 9 (1 point) On January 1, 202X, Hawks Delivery Inc. purchased a van to deliver goods at the beginning of the current year. The vendor offered Hawks Delivery Inc. financing terms that required Hawks Delivery Inc. to make 6 equal semi-annual payments of $ 42000 at the end of every second quarter. The current interest rate for Hawks Delivery Inc. is 10%. How much would Hawks Delivery Inc. record as the initial purchase price of the van? Round your answer to the nearest dollar.
